Acronyms, Abbreviations, and Initialisms.
All human edited and we add more daily

The meaning of the Acronym TLSA is...

TLSA is

  • Torso Limb Suit Assembly

TLSA is also in:

Acronym Definition Searched: NBCP PS POMS MAC UAG TCD NSI WVHQ ETRR EMSA TCEB 02148 Eurotecnet DGIT CIO